As a Stacker, you will be part of a service-oriented team that opens the door to exciting yet comfortable urban adventures. Your compassionate attendance to guests' needs will serve as an inspiration to teammates, driving the kind of energized atmosphere that separates us from the competition.


Principal Duties & Responsibilities

Provide exceptional, courteous, friendly service to guests and employees.

Keep Garage organized to maximize parking potential.

Assist Valet attendants to park efficiently in the garage.

Assist Valet attendants who are in the process of retrieving vehicles.

Assist guests promptly and courteously in valet check-in.

Park vehicles in designated areas in accordance with standard stacking procedures to maximize speed and efficiency of parking service.

Promptly clear valet area of cars to be parked.

Maintain a working knowledge of the facilities, as well as special events on property, in order to advise guests and fellow employees of same, whenever possible.

Drive company vehicles as necessary.

Maintain a clean DMV record.

Provide a current Nevada Motor Vehicle Report to the department leader and Risk Management every 6 months

Immediately notify department leader of any changes to the Nevada Driver’s License status.

Contact appropriate supervisor on guest related complaints.

Full knowledge and understanding of company and department rules and regulations, policies and procedures.

Assist employees within the Transportation department as needed.

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ities

KSAs

Ability to safely drive vehicles, including those with manual transmission.

Strong written and verbal communication skills with the ability to effectively communicate in English.

Knowledge of pertinent laws and regulations impacting Transportation Department including Guest Safety and OSHA.

Ability to obtain and maintain full knowledge and understanding of company and department rules and regulations, policies and procedures.

Polished appearance and demeanor.

Excellent customer service skills.

Basic computer skills.
